A Play, a Pie and a Pint is currently recruiting for the role of Assistant Producer

Assistant Producer Job Description

Role: Assistant Producer

Contract Length: Permanent (full time)

Responsible to: Producer

Experience level:       

This is an ideal position for someone who is beginning or at an early level of their career in theatre/ the arts.

Overall Purpose:       

To assist with the day to day activity and administration of the organisation, across all activity strands. The Assistant Producer will work together with the Producer and Creative Team to help realise the artistic vision of A Play, a Pie and a Pint.

Key Responsibilities and Main Duties:        

A Play, a Pie and a Pint is a continually developing organisation. In addition to the responsibilities listed below, the post holder will be expected to contribute to any or all aspects of the organisational development when appropriate and in consultation with the Producer.

ADMINISTRATION:

  • Answer all general queries from the public relating to A Play, A Pie and A Pint via website, social media, phone and email.
  • Assist Producer with casting: Availability checks/setting up auditions.
  • Assist Producer with drawing up actors’ contracts.
  • Distribute accommodation lists and advise on sub payments.
  • Occasionally arrange travel/accommodation.
  • Compiling contact lists for companies
  • Print scripts as required.
  • Collating audience survey information.

MARKETING:

  • Arrange and oversee the weekly photo call/interview with media partners.
  • Arrange complimentary tickets for company members.
  • Collate season information and order season leaflets, placemats and banners.
  • Distribute marketing material both internally and externally of Oran Mor.
  • Organise online listings.
  • Send online content to website manager and occasionally update content.
  • Film weekly ‘sneak peek’ videos.

VENUE MANAGEMENT:

  • Arrange technical afternoon in the venue for plays in rehearsals with the Technical Manager when required, and liaise with appropriate departments.
  • Assist Associate Producer with arranging rehearsal schedules.
  • Co-ordinate with venue managers on ticket sales and management of additional seats.

COMPANY MANAGEMENT:

Assist the Producer with the following:

  • Liaising with directors of upcoming shows and call the company for rehearsals.
  • Attend read-throughs/ runs of shows as required.
  • Supervise the tech/dress on a Monday morning as required.
  • Look after the companies in rehearsal, answering questions and liaising between departments as required.
  • Introduce the show in performance as required.
  • Liaise with other venues to ensure smooth transfer of shows.

GENERAL:

  • Apply discretion at all times when liaising with company members and representing the organization externally.
  • Deputise for the Producer as and when required.
  • Attend other theatre shows and keep abreast of arts developments in Scotland.
  • Any other reasonable duties as requested by the Artistic Directors/Producer.
